**SUMMARY**
Responsible for all electronic video surveillance systems in order to observe and monitor customers and employees for any violations of the Alberta Gaming Terms and /Conditions or company policies and procedures, to report violations as required, and to ensure for the safety and security of all customers, employees, and company assets. Uphold and maintain the integrity of the casino to the best of their abilities.
**QUALIFICATIONS**
Demonstrated thorough knowledge of casino operations and the Alberta Gaming and Liquor Commission’s Terms and Conditions. Demonstrated effective and diplomatic customer service and communication skills, which includes contracts with staff members, police, AGLC, and other regulatory officials. Demonstrated experience perfo9rming within specific deadlines or under pressure. Demonstrated experience problem solving, organizing and prioritizing work. Demonstrated experience in surveillance operations preferably within a gaming environment. Demonstrated effective and diplomatic communication skills, which includes experience handling difficult and sensitive surveillance investigations. Demonstrated technical knowledge of computers and their multiple uses. Demonstrated mature and responsible behavior at all times. Must be eighteen (18) years of age or older.
**E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E**
Prior experience as a surveillance operator is preferred. Experience in the gaming industry is an asset.
**C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S**
Must have a valid and current Alberta Gaming and Liquor Commission Gaming License and any other Alberta Gaming and Liquor Control registration requirements.
**OTHER SKILLS AND ABILITIES**
Knowledge of Century Casino, FINTRAC and AGLC’s policies and procedures and how they pertain to surveillance. Must have and maintain professional radio communication when communicating with security, slot and pit staff using two-way radios. Knowledge of a phonetic alphabet beneficial.
